Output 03d7159439b10c60076e54062e65adc0c2a4aa057046d1d31a1f19b35a681fe5:1

value
21192107504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70501eddb5446ce08f498abf981e44c6df59fc59 OP_EQUAL
address
MJ91tnmuQTZYVbTK2Pxn9KxFtL3QuFMB2q
transaction
03d7159439b10c60076e54062e65adc0c2a4aa057046d1d31a1f19b35a681fe5
spent
true